Behçet's disease is a rare inflammatory condition that affects multiple parts of the body, including the skin, eyes, and blood vessels. Diagnosing Behçet's disease can be challenging, as there is no single test that confirms it. Instead, doctors use a combination of clinical criteria and various blood tests to identify markers that suggest the presence of the disease. What is Behçet's Disease?
Behçet's disease is a chronic condition characterized by inflammation of blood vessels throughout the body. It can lead to symptoms such as mouth sores, genital sores, eye inflammation, and skin lesions. The exact cause of Behçet's disease is unknown, but it is believed to involve genetic, environmental, and immune system factors. Due to its complex nature, diagnosing Behçet's disease often requires a comprehensive approach, including clinical evaluations and laboratory tests.
Key Blood Markers for Behçet's Disease
While there is no specific blood test for Behçet's disease, several markers can indicate inflammation and help in the diagnostic process:
C-Reactive Protein (CRP): CRP is a protein produced by the liver in response to inflammation. Elevated CRP levels can indicate inflammation in the body, which is a common feature of Behçet's disease.
Erythrocyte Sedimentation Rate (ESR): ESR is another marker of inflammation. It measures how quickly red blood cells settle at the bottom of a test tube. A higher ESR indicates more inflammation, which can be associated with Behçet's disease.
Complete Blood Count (CBC): A CBC can reveal anemia or an elevated white blood cell count, both of which can occur in patients with Behçet's disease.
Human Leukocyte Antigen (HLA-B51): This genetic marker is more commonly found in individuals with Behçet's disease, particularly those of Mediterranean or Asian descent. While not definitive, the presence of HLA-B51 can support a diagnosis when other symptoms are present.
Why These Markers Matter
The presence of these markers helps healthcare professionals assess the level of inflammation in the body and supports the diagnosis of Behçet's disease. Although these tests are not specific to Behçet's, they provide valuable information about the body's inflammatory state and help rule out other conditions with similar symptoms.
Frequently Asked Questions
Q: Can Behçet's disease be diagnosed with a single blood test? A: No, Behçet's disease cannot be diagnosed with a single blood test. Diagnosis involves a combination of clinical criteria and multiple tests to assess inflammation and rule out other conditions.
Q: Is a high CRP level always indicative of Behçet's disease? A: Not necessarily. High CRP levels indicate inflammation, which can occur in many conditions. It is one piece of the puzzle in diagnosing Behçet's disease.
Q: How is the HLA-B51 marker used in diagnosing Behçet's disease? A: The HLA-B51 marker is more common in people with Behçet's disease but is not definitive on its own. It is used in conjunction with other diagnostic criteria.
Q: Are there any other tests needed besides blood tests to diagnose Behçet's disease? A: Yes, doctors may use additional tests such as skin pathergy tests or imaging studies to aid in diagnosis.
When to See a Doctor
If you experience symptoms such as recurring mouth or genital sores, eye inflammation, or unexplained skin lesions, it is important to consult a healthcare professional. Early evaluation and diagnosis can help manage symptoms and improve quality of life.
